Brokerage compensation is part of your insurance premium. For your benefit, we have listed below commercial insurers that we represent and have included the range of compensation each provides as a percentage of your overall premium.

*AVIVA CANADA INC. 7.5% TO 20%
*AXA INSURANCE CANADA 7.5% TO 20%
*DOMINION OF CANADA 10% TO 20%, FACILITY (ROYAL) 6% TO 10%
*GUARANTEE COMPANY OF NORTH AMERICA 10% TO 25%
*INTACT INSURANCE COMPANY 7.5% TO 20%
*LOMBARD CANADA LTD. 7.5% T0 20%
*ST. PAUL TRAVELERS FIRE & MARINE INSURANCE COMPANY 15% TO 20%
*THE SOVEREIGN GENERAL INSURANCE COMPANY 10% TO 22.5%
*WAWANESA MUTUAL INSURANCE COMPANY 7.5% TO 20%
*ZURICH NORTH AMERICA CANADA 7.5% TO 20%.

This commission percentage is paid annual for both new business and renewals.

Should there be an increase in commission schedule we receive from your insurer, or, any other material change that affects compensation arrangements, we will notify you.

In order for us to maintain strong relationships with quality insurers, we work with each to provide the type of business they desire. The insurers with an asterisk * noted above recognize our efforts through a contingent (profit commission contract, (and or sales incentives).

Payment of this contingent (profit) commission may depend on a combination of growth, profitability (loss ratio), volume, retention and increased services that we provide on behalf of the insurer. Contingent (profit) commission is not guaranteed. For detailed information on contingent commission, please go to the individual company’s website.
